KS2 Primary Teacher

Location: Aylesbury
Start Date: September
Contract Type: Full Time | Long‑Term
Salary: £29,344-£44,919

Monday Morning

You arrive knowing exactly what your expectations are — and what the school expects from you. Lessons begin on time. Routines are embedded. Students know how the room works before you even speak.

Your role here is not to fight behaviour, but to teach.

Across the week, you will work with mixed‑ability classes, delivering structured, purposeful lessons that prioritise clarity, consistency, and measurable progress. You will plan lessons carefully, not to impress, but to ensure students understand what they are learning and why it matters.

What You Will Actually Be Responsible For

This role is built around professional teaching practice.

You will:

Plan and deliver lessons with clear learning objectives
Establish calm, predictable classroom routines
Communicate expectations clearly and consistently
Adapt teaching for learners who need support or challenge
Assess work regularly and use feedback to drive progress
Maintain accurate records of attainment and engagement
Contribute to planning discussions and curriculum refinement
Work collaboratively with colleagues rather than in isolation
Required Knowledge and Skills

Experience supporting primary‑aged pupils

Strong literacy and numeracy skills

Clear spoken English

Ability to motivate and encourage learners

Organised and reliable approach

QTS – unqualifed teachers feel free to apply!
